Albania's "People's Hero"

Shehu was born in 1913 in a small Albanian village called Joros.

Shehu's family is not poor, so there is enough money to send him to school.

After finishing primary school in his hometown, Shehu went to Tirana Secondary Technical School, where he studied agricultural mechanics until graduating in 1932.

However, Albania was under the autocratic rule of the Sogu dynasty, and the authorities pursued a pro-Italian traitorous policy.

A year later, Shehu was sent to study at the Naples Military School in Italy.

However, he was soon recalled by the Albanian authorities for being accused of anti-fascist progressive ideas in Italy.

Upon his return to Albania, Shehu was arrested and imprisoned, and continued to be persecuted by the authorities after his release.

In July 1936, the Spanish Civil War broke out.

In order to support the Spanish people in their struggle to defend the Republic and oppose the Franco fascist rebellion, the Comintern International set up an international column.

In November 1937, Shehu traveled to France as an international student, then set off from Paris, crossed the Pyrenees, and entered Spain, joining the 2nd Brigade of the International Column "Garibal's".

In the battle to defend the Republic, Xie Hu fought bravely and well, and was successively promoted from an ordinary machine gunner to platoon commander, company commander, and deputy battalion commander. In December 1937, he was admitted as a member of the Communist Party of Spain.

More than two years later, after the end of the civil war in Western Banya, Shehu withdrew with the international column to France, where he was imprisoned by the French authorities in a concentration camp for forty months.

In the camp, he joined the Italian Communist Party as a member of the party.

In April 1939, Italian fascist forces of Mussolini occupied Albania.

Four years later, Shehu returned to his homeland, joined the Albanian Communist Party, devoted himself to the anti-fascist struggle, and served as a member of the party committee and organization secretary of the Vlora region.

In May 1944, at the First Congress of Albanian Anti-Fascist National Liberation in Permet, Shehu was elected a member of the National Committee against Fascism and was awarded the rank of colonel.

The congress decided to establish divisions and corps of the National Liberation Army, with Shehu as commander of the 1st Assault Division.

In November of the same year, Shehu commanded the battle for the liberation of Tirana, was promoted to major general, and was appointed deputy chief of the general staff of the National Liberation Army.

After the liberation of Albania, Shehu rose through the ranks of lieutenant general, was elected a member of the Politburo, and served as chairman of the Council of Ministers from July 1954 until his death.

It can be said that Shehu has always been an important leader of the Albanian party, government and army, and was once awarded medals such as "People's Hero".

The Higher Military Academy of Albania is also named after him.

However, it was such an important political figure who mysteriously committed suicide in 1981.

Shehu was suspicious

December 18, 1981, Albania, the "Land of Mountain Eagles".

As usual, people were immersed in a peaceful atmosphere.

Suddenly, a shocking news came from the radio: Mohamed Shehu, the second largest person in Albania, a close comrade-in-arms of Hoxha, the first secretary of the Albanian Workers' Party and prime minister of the Albanian government for 28 years, "committed suicide due to insanity".

As soon as the news came out, people were surprised and talked about it.

Speculation about the death of Mohammed Shehu is rife in the streets: some believe that Mohammed Shehu committed suicide before shooting Hoxha.

Some pigs test that Hoxha personally shot and killed Shehu; Some people say that Shehu shot first but did not kill Hoxha, but was killed by Hoxha's guards; Others say that Shehu was "secretly executed" after being arrested by Hazbiu, the Minister of Internal Affairs who received Hoxha's orders... It's a strange story.

Hoxha has his own version of Shehu's death.

At the end of the year after Shehu's death, Hoxha published a book called The Titoists.

The book gives an official explanation of the ins and outs of Shehu's suicide.

The book mentions that in fact, when Shehu was studying in the United States in 1930, he had become a spy for the CIA.

And this was not his first role, during the Spanish campaign, Shehu became a spy for British intelligence in 1939.

All of the above are written by Hoxha in the book, and although it can justify itself, it is difficult to believe.

Whether Shehu committed suicide is actually doubtful.

His chief guard also provided the media with an opinion on Shehu's death.

A few days after Shehu's "suicide," Ali Chena, who had served as his long-time chief guard, together with Shehu's family, was arrested and imprisoned for "defecting to foreign intelligence services," spending eight years behind bars.

When Chener was released in 1989 and worked as a physical education teacher at a secondary school in the capital, Tirana, he later replied in an interview with reporters:

"I was Shehu's chief guard from 1972 until the night of Shehu's death, and I was by his side at all times."

"I found that he realized that disaster was coming quite long before he died, and he felt a constant threat that he would either be removed or die in vain. I was on guard outside his house the night he died, and I'm sure he wouldn't kill himself. ”

As for why the chief guard felt that Shehu would not commit suicide, he said that he judged it from his character.

Doctors told Shehu's family that Shehu had been shot through the heart with a pistol and had died.

But the chief guard and his family felt very strange, ordinary people use pistols to commit suicide at the temple, why did Shehu aim at his heart?

In addition, there are many doubts.

After Shehu's death was billed, the staff of the Albanian Ministry of Internal Affairs conducted a pistol experiment.

They closed the doors and windows in Shehu's room, and then fired a bullet with the Makarov pistol that Shehu said had used to commit suicide.

They found that the bullet made a loud noise after it was fired.

The place where the guard stands outside the house can be heard clearly, even further away.

So they thought that Shehu could not have committed suicide with his own pistol, because the loud noise would attract many people in the residence.

But Shehu died quietly, which suggests that he must have killed him, and the murderer used a silent pistol, not the one they found next to Shehu's body.

He was a very authoritarian leader who put his name on an equal footing with Marx and Engels.

Fight mercilessly against dissidents until they are physically eliminated - killed.

From 1940 to 1975, Hoxha carried out thirteen purges within the party.

What is even more frightening is that between 1973 and 1975 alone, he purged three so-called reactionary groups and almost completely eliminated the older generation of leaders of the Albanian Party.

And in this way, only Hoxha was left with the "big" Politburo member.

However, with the rapid expansion of Shehu's power, Hoxha could no longer rest assured of Shehu, and the relationship between the two became more and more tense, until finally broke out, causing Shehu's death.
